Inclusion Criteria:
- Patients with PR according to Guerne and Weissman modified criteria (18) and with:
- Disease evolution > 3 months and < 24 months.
- ACPA positivity proven by ELISA test or chemiluminescence (CCP2) and/or Rheumatoid factor positivity (ELISA, nephelometry or chemiluminescence).
- Greater than 18 years of age.
Exclusion Criteria:
- Persistent arthritis: (involvement in one or more joints > 1 week).
- Criteria of other rheumatic diseases (RA, SLE, etc.).
- Evidence of radiographic damage (join erosions).
- Absence of ACPA or RF.
- Contraindication or intolerance to study drugs (abatacept or hydroxychloroquine).
- Steroid treatment one month before study entry.
- Previous antitrheumatic therapy with synthetic DMARDS (methotrexate, leflunomide, sulfasalazine, cyclosporine, antimalarials.) or biological DMARDs.
- Pregnant women or who want to be pregnant during the study.

Experimental: abatacept
abatacept monotherapy (subcutaneous route).: 125 mg solution for injection in pre-filled syringe.
In the first year (0-12 months) at a a dose of 125 mg per week (full dose) and in the second year (12-24 months) at a dose of 125 mg every other week (q2w) (optimized dose) injection) - 125 mg x week - subcutaneous use.
|
Abatacept subcutaneous in monotherapy 125 mg/week during the first year (12 months).
Abtacept subcutaneus in monotherapy 125 mg/2weeks during the second year.
Other Names:
|
|
Active Comparator: hydroxycloroquina
Hydroxyclorquina (Coated tablet)- (5 mg/Kg/day) monotherapy for 2 years (0-48 months)
|
oral hydroxycloroquina 5 mg/Kg/day for 2 years (0-48 months)
